Why does the firmware matter on the PSP's? I'm not too familiar with them. I rather watch my movies on my axim but at a good price I wouldn't mind picking one up.
The PSP isn't a good buy until they start releasing some original games for it, instead of stripped down versions of PS2 games. And unless you travel alot, it's a total waste to get and play at home.
I'm a huge playstation fan, but when it comes to portable gaming - stick with the DS.
#2, firmware really matters if you plan on using homebrewed software(more robust video players, emulators, and the like). Most later firmware prevents their use, but keeping a lower rev firmware means you can't play some newer games.
